As you all know, Confluence is runing version 8.5.16. There is a notice internally that the AWS PostGRESQL version that is currently running (V12) has to be upgraded to 16 or higher as V12 is going end of support.
However, confuence 8.5.16 does not support PostGRESQL 16 - it supports only V12, V13, V14.
Can we upgrade to PostGRESQL V14? Please confirm.
Although there shouldn't be much difference between 14 and 16, I would test it first.
This is a good opportunity to contact Atlassian support and ask what are the issues you might face when using a different DB version.
